The Eastern Shore Honey Vodka Cocktail is beautiful and easy to make.

You can make it in minutes with 3 simple ingredients; vodka, honey, and lemonade. We suggest using your favorite vodka, as it adds character to the cocktail. Then, add a dash of honey for a rich and unique flavor. Our Blackberry honey is the most preferred option because of its excellent fruity sweetness that complements the vodka's smooth taste perfectly. However, if you prefer less sweet cocktails, try using Wildflower honey. It has a gentler flavor and sweetness that pairs well with the lemonade. Fresh-sqeezed lemonade gives the cocktail the right amount of sourness, which balances the sweetness of the honey.



To make the drink, add ice cubes to a shaker, then add vodka and honey. Shake the mixture well, then strain and add lemonade. Stir the mixture, and your Eastern Shore Honey Vodka Cocktail is ready to sip.

Another way to make the drink more interesting is to add a couple of mint leaves. The fresh and fragrant flavors of the spice elevate the drink's taste and aroma, making it more refreshing and exciting to drink.

Adapting this Eastern Shore Vodka Cocktail

Recipes are meant to be inspiration. That’s the way we see it. Don’t feel like you have to make this Honey Vodka Cocktail exactly the way our recipe shows. Drinks are the perfect thing to experiment with based on your tastes. Try something different, or change it up based on the season. Here are some ideas in case you need a little boost with adapting this recipe:

  • Add some blueberries, or a combination of your favorite berries, and muddle them into the mix to add color and flavor.
  • Use a fruity or botanical infused vodka, if you don't like plain vodka. Choose a flavored vodka that pairs well with honey and the garnish of your choice.
  • Can you imagine making Raven Tea and adding it to the mixer? That would be so good!
  • Why not add a few slices of fresh sliced ginger to the mix?
